If you are celebrating upcoming holidays, you may be in the midst of wrapping gifts. And sometimes it’s nice to fashion a very special gift box and tag for that certain someone. Though I’m sharing this creative idea around Christmas time, this box & tag combo would be great for Valentine’s Day or just to give to that special person at any time to let them know how grateful you are for them.
Here are the details for this box that measures approximately 7″ x 9-1/4″ x 3/4″ when assembled.
Products I used… See below for a complete list of extra products I used linked to where you can find them in my online store.
Measurements…
Basic Black Cardstock
10-3/4″ x 8-1/2″ scored at 3/4″ on all four sides
Scrap for die-cutting large star
Christmastime is Here Specialty Designer Paper
10-5/16″ x 8-1/16″ (a little over 10-1/4″ x a little over 8″) scored at 1/2″ on all four sides
Gold Foil Sheets
Scrap for die-cutting starry swirl
Cherry Cobbler Cardstock
Scrap for die-cutting large star
Whisper White Cardstock
Scrap for stamping and punching sentiment circle
Black Satin Ribbon
33″
Directions…
After cutting and scoring box base and box top pieces, trim in once on all four corners to make tabs, add Tear & Tape (as shown), fold on score lines, and connect tabs.
Add the ribbon and tie in a bow.
Die-cut the Basic Black star, the Cherry Cobbler star, and the Gold Foil starry swirl. Pop out the little stars.
Stamp the sentiment on the Whisper White scrap. Then punch it out.
Layer the Cherry Cobbler star onto the Gold Foil swirl. Then layer this onto the Basic Black. Add the sentiment circle with Dimensionals. Then add the small the gold stars here and there with Glue Dots.
Then just add the tag to the top of the box.

I had to play around with that beautiful Wrapped in Plaid Designer Paper one more time. This is the latest card I made.
Products I used… See below for a complete list of extra products I used linked to where you can find them in my online store.
Measurements…
Whisper White Thick Cardstock
4-1/4” x 11″ scored parallel to the short side at 5-1/2”
4-1/4″ x 4-1/4″
Wrapped In Plaid Designer Paper
2″ x 3-7/8″
Gold Foil Sheets
1/4″ x 4-1/2″ (two strips)
Directions…
Measure and mark 1-3/4″ up from the bottom left corner and 1-3/4″ down from the top right corner of the 4-1/4″ x 4-1/4″ Whisper White piece. Cut diagonally from mark to mark using Trimmer.
Adhere the Gold Foil strips just inside the diagonal edge on each piece using SNAIL.
Die-cut each piece with the 4″ x 2-5/8″ Stitched Rectangle Die to get the stitched look on the straight edges. Stamp the sentiment above the gold strip on the one that will be on top.
Adhere the designer paper on the card front with SNAIL so it is centered.
Add the top stitched piece and the bottom stitched piece using Dimensionals.
Finish with a couple rhinestones.

Do you need a last minute holiday card idea? If you have the Most Wonderful Time Product Medley, or you feel like ordering it now and either rushing your order or sending your cards out closer to the end of December, I have a card to share with you today that is easy to make and is OH SOOOooo peaceful and pretty. (Gosh, you could even get a head start on next year’s cards.) A big thank you to Amy Rich for the inspiration.
And here is the card I made using this medley, the Stitched Shapes Dies, the Everyday Label Punch, some cardstock, the Night of Navy ink, and a sponge.
Products I used… See below for a complete list of extra products I used linked to where you can find them in my online store.
Measurements…
Night of Navy Cardstock
4-1/4” x 11″ scored parallel to the short side at 5-1/2”
Whisper White Cardstock
3-1/2″ x 4-3/4″ (for the inside)
2-7/8″ x 4-1/8″
1″ x 3-1/2″
Scrap for stamping and punching sentiment piece
Gold Foil Sheets
Scrap for die-cutting stitched circle piece
White and gold-foiled star card from the kit
2-3/4″ x 4″
Directions…
Stamp the sentiment. Punch it out so that the sentiment is positioned more towards one end of the punch.
Then insert the punched sentiment and punch again to shorten it up and get rid of the extra white space.
Die-cut the stitched circle. Then layer the sentiment piece onto the stitched circle using a Dimensional.
Pounce the dust from the Embossing Buddy onto the back of the reindeer sticker to “get rid of” the stickiness.
Add Night of Navy ink to the white and gold-foiled star card from the kit by moving an inked up sponge in a circular motion. Starting at the top and moving down will help to produce that gradual dark to light look since the ink lessens from the sponge the longer you use it before re-inking. The foiled stars will resist the ink, but it will help to wipe the surface with a tissue afterwards to get rid of any ink that is sitting on top of the foiled areas. Layer the gold-foiled star paper onto the 2-7/8″ x 4-1/8″ Whisper White.
Tear along one long edge of the 1″ x 3-1/2″ Whisper White piece to make a snowy ground.
Adhere the 3-1/2″ x 4-3/4″ Whisper White piece centered on the inside with SNAIL.
Adhere the sponged star layer on the front with SNAIL.
Adhere the snowy ground with Dimensionals.
Adhere the reindeer with Dimensionals.
Adhere the layered sentiment piece with SNAIL.
Stick on a few star embellishments from the medley.

Two more ideas for all of you who received the Winter Gifts November 2019 Paper Pumpkin kit
I love the challenge each month of coming up with my final card design (a card for 5 of my lucky subscribers) using my leftovers from what I’ve already created with my kit. (And as you may guess from what I’ve made and shared already on November 23 and November 28, there weren’t that many supplies left over.) PLUS there is of course the added challenge that I need to make 6 identical cards from these leftovers (1 for me and 5 for those subscribers). But I did it!
My valentine card is definitely “outside the box” – not Christmas-themed at all as one would expect with this kit. I used a couple new products that will be made available to all come January 3… products debuting in the 2020 Spring Catalog: The Heart Punch Pack and the Heart Doilies. Here are the details if you wish to recreate this card.
Products I used… See below for a complete list of extra products I used linked to where you can find them in my online store.
Measurements…
Whisper White Thick Cardstock
4-1/4” x 11″ scored parallel to the short side at 5-1/2”
Early Espresso Cardstock
4-1/8” x 5-3/8″
Poppy Parade Cardstock
Scrap for punching the scalloped heart and the small heart
Sahara Sand Cardstock
3/8″ x 2-3/4″
Silver Glimmer Paper
Scrap for punching the large heart
Kit sled
For punching the large heart and the small heart
Kit silver twine
7″
Directions…
Emboss the Early Espresso Cardstock.
Punch the hearts.
Trim up the bottom end of the Silver Glimmer Paper heart (as shown). Then use Glue Dots (from the Online Store as they are thicker) to add the Glimmer Paper heart to the Heart Doily. You’ll want to see the silver sparkle show through the punched holes in the Heart Doily.
Stamp your sentiment to the right on the Sahara Sand Cardstock strip. Either mask the stamp to ink up only the “with love” portion or cut your stamp before inking.
Tie a bow with the twine.
Layer the woodgrain heart onto the Poppy Parade scalloped heart.
Assemble your card by adding the doily first and then the sentiment strip so the right edge is flush with the right edge of the Early Espresso layer. Continue to use SNAIL Adhesive and add this Early Espresso layer to the Whisper White card base.
Now add the layered woodgrain heart with Dimensionals from the kit and the silver twine bow and little hearts with Glue Dots from the kit.
Finally adhere a large silver sequin from the kit to the center of the O in LOVE.
